Publisher's Summary
After one concussion too many, Ben Leit is done as the NFL’s golden boy quarterback. Then, his father, who was about to expose a bombshell sports scandal, is murdered.
While Ben sets himself up as the killer's next target Mimi Fitzroy, CIO for Rex Sports International, panics when she discovers somebody was using Rex to stalk the recently murdered Frank Leit. Worse, she finds thousands of stolen emails that prove Rex is breaking a ton of federal laws.
Ben and Mimi find a connection they didn’t want and weren’t looking for. As for whether they can trap the killer before the killer takes them out? The three of them are headed for an explosive showdown in Seattle...and not everyone will walk away.
